Commercial Treadmills

Commercial treadmills are built to stand up to the wear and tear of high-traffic gyms and fitness centers. They are also made for use in physical therapy clinics as well as other similar fitness facilities. They tend to be more durable, have higher capacities for weight, and have advanced features such as customizable workout programs and touchscreens that monitor the progress.

Most importantly, commercial treadmills generally have a higher motor horsepower rating (CHP) than standard models. The higher CHP of commercial treadmills allow them to support greater frequency of use and intense training. Additionally, they are often equipped with cooling fans to minimize the chance of technical issues caused by overheating and require less maintenance than traditional treadmills.

Many of these machines have adjustable incline settings to simulate the sensation of walking uphill or running. This improves posture, strengthens muscles and burns more calories. Many of them offer an option to decrease, which is beneficial for those who are working on their running technique.

Another benefit of commercial treadmills is that they typically have a large weight capacity, making them more accessible to people with different fitness levels and body types. They can accommodate people weighing up to 400 pounds or more, which is a sign of accessibility and makes working out on a treadmill for sale near me feel more comfortable for a wider range of people.

The price of these models is usually prohibitive despite the advantages. When deciding whether to invest in one of these machines, it is crucial to take into consideration the following factors:

How many people will be expected to be using the treadmill? How often? How much space is available for the machine in your home? Do you require additional features such as integrated tracking systems or fitness apps? Once you have the answers to these questions, you will be able to decide if a commercial treadmill would be an investment worthy of your office or at home.

Used Treadmills

Treadmills offer a full cardio workout for runners, walkers or anyone who wants to increase their fitness. The modern features of new treadmills might be appealing to some people, but for those who do not require them, a secondhand treadmill can offer a fantastic workout without the need to spend money on gym memberships or travel expenses.

It's important to check the condition of the treadmill you're using and especially the motor. It must be in good working order and free of damage. It will require expensive repairs in the near future if it is not in good condition. It's also worth assessing the belt for obvious tears, warps, or other indications of wear and tear.

Another thing to consider is how much the treadmill has been used. If it's been used extensively, then you'll likely have to replace it earlier than a treadmill that's been hardly used at all. You can ask the seller for this, or if you purchase from a reputable retailer they should be able provide service records for the treadmill.

Think about the treadmill's incline as well as decline capabilities. This is especially important for serious runners. Treadmills that have a steeper slope permit you to focus on specific muscles and increase endurance without making an additional trip outside. This is particularly important for people who live in areas with hills.

You should also be aware of the cushioning provided by treadmills. It's not an important selling point however it can help reduce the impact on your joints. Brands like Precor and Life Fitness build their treadmills with a greater cushioning in the front, where your foot will land. They also offer stability when you push off.
